Featured Research Articles
Recent publications highlight various aspects of sports science and active living:
- Sprint Performance Enhancement: One study examines the effects of inspiratory muscle pre-activation on 100m sprint performance in physically active university students. This suggests that specific warm-up techniques targeting respiratory muscles might play a role in athletic output.
- Female Athlete Physiology: An accelerometry-based study investigates daily physical activity patterns across the menstrual cycle in eumenorrheic female athletes. This research underscores the importance of understanding physiological cycles in training and performance Source.
- Youth Athlete Development: Another article explores ideomotor representation, motor control, and body aesthetics in juvenile rhythmic gymnasts, focusing on personalized training programs.
- Non-Olympic Sports Sustainability: Research also touches upon the sustainability of non-Olympic sports within stratified sport systems, examining institutional constraints.

Can understanding menstrual cycles affect athletic training?+
Yes, research indicates that daily physical activity patterns can vary across the menstrual cycle in female athletes, suggesting individualized training and nutrition plans could be beneficial.
What is 'inspiratory muscle pre-activation' and why is it studied?+
Inspiratory muscle pre-activation refers to warming up the breathing muscles before exercise. It's studied to see if it can enhance performance, such as in 100m sprinting.
